Bill O'Brien is a prominent football coach known for his successful tenure as the head coach at Penn State University, where he guided the Nittany Lions through a challenging period following the Jerry Sandusky scandal. O'Brien has also served as the head coach of the Houston Texans in the NFL. In recent news, he was set to welcome Matt McGloin to his coaching staff at Boston College before McGloin's sudden resignation due to family considerations.
